Let me point out that I always said IF Dahroug's people did it the careful, door to door way his sigs would be more reliable. I always admitted I was going on his campaign's statements on the matter. IF his campaign did not do the process properly, then he definitely needed to gather a couple thousand extra sigs.
Let me reiterate that there are two ways to do the petitioning process: go door to door with a walk list making sure each and every sig is the correct one, or gather 5x more sigs you need in a more scattershot manner hoping that at least 1/5 is valid. Here in Brooklyn the people I know tend to combine the two methods: going door to door and being careful to confirm most sigs, but ALSO getting 3-5x what you actually need. Neither candidate in the Dahroug/Foley primary met the standard I am used to candidates reaching. Dahroug's people claimed they did the first strategy, but seems that may not be the case.
